I've played now the Dream Forest in the Atari Jaguar version and I'm amazed by noticing some significant differences in this version.
Like:
- Rayman's crawling animation is different. He also does not have the "speed" animation when he is falling quick from a plum
- The Tentakel seems to be defeatable
- The Antitoons helicopter is yellow-coloured
- The Moskito's colours are slightly different (and he appears to be more resistant and quicker than in all the other versions)
- The last part of the Anguish Lagoon is very different (the famous shooting part)
- Some level objects are slightly changed to other locations
- Some objects appear in places that don't appear in other versions
- It appears that the cages locations slightly mix the PS1 and PC versions
- Rayman's controls seem more inaccurate, and this makes the game harder
- Some objects behave a little differently than in the other versions (for example: the small water lilies fall immediately while in the other versions there's a second of delay before falling)
- Some enemies behave differently than in the other versions (like for example: The Hunters being more vulnerable here)
- Rayman loses the Speed Fist or the Golden Fist everytime he gets hit
- When Rayman dies, he loses all his Tings
- Betilla's dialogues are a little different than in the other versions
- There are some background changes, like the background where Rayman gets the Grappling Power.
At least Moskito did his first appearance with the colours of his battle in the nest. This definitely prooves that the fact that Moskito appears with Bzzit's colours in the pursuit with the big dry fruit in all the other versions is a colouring error.
